We participated in the META Motion 2024 | The Usefulness of the Useless exhibition, organized by our partner META Design at Songshan Cultural and Creative Park at the end of 2024. As part of the event, we opened our office space to the public, allowing visitors to see firsthand how construction waste is transformed into unique creations.
During the exhibition, we hosted four workplace tours, attracting visitors from different fields. Each tour began with a simple and engaging presentation, introducing Taiwan’s construction industry, the challenges of handling construction waste, and our company’s vision for the future. With this basic understanding, visitors could better appreciate that our office—built using construction waste—is not just a temporary gimmick but an effort to integrate sustainability into daily work life and corporate culture.

As visitors explored each floor, they not only admired the works on display but also heard honest stories about the challenges we faced. Project 1.0 introduced an office space built from construction waste, completely different from the traditional "white-collar office" environment. This contrast sparked strong reactions—both positive and negative—but more importantly, it created a valuable opportunity for internal discussions. Project 2.0 experimented with refining construction waste into high-quality furniture, proving that sustainability and aesthetics can coexist. Project 3.0 focused on increasing efficiency in repurposing construction waste, working with partners to develop new recycled materials.

Faced with questions from visitors, including professionals from the construction industry, we embraced an open-minded approach, sharing our progress and experiences. We believe that sustainability and shared knowledge can only grow stronger when more people participate. These projects not only raised public awareness but also sparked ongoing internal discussions about how businesses can take responsibility for environmental impact and implement real change.
